Illumina has acquired cloud-based, rapidly configurable omics data analysis platform developer BlueBee for an undisclosed price, in a deal designed to accelerate the sequencing giant’s analysis and sharing of next-generation sequencing (NGS) data at scale.

By incorporating BlueBee’s genomics analysis solutions designed to extract insights from genomic data into its cloud portfolio, Illumina reasons it can better serve the clinical, translational research, population genomics, and biopharma customer markets. Illumina said it expects BlueBee’s cloud capability to lower the cost of storing, sharing and managing the genomic data that streams from Illumina’s installed base of more than 15,000 sequencing systems.

Illumina’s cloud software portfolio includes BaseSpace™ Sequencing Hub, a software solution intended for sequencing run management and data sharing. Illumina added that its cloud portfolio users will gain the flexibility to run their own custom analyses or access options such as the DRAGEN™ Bio-IT Platform, with the aims of streamlining their data processing and increasing their operational efficiency.

Users also will be able to aggregate, explore, and collaborate on data and methods directly in the cloud through a user-friendly, ISO-compliant, flexible interface, Illumina said.

BlueBee’s offerings include BlueFlow intuitive analysis management, BlueBase multi-modal data management, and BlueBench data science and AI tools, as well as integrated business analytics, and multi-cloud or on-premise deployment modes.

BlueBee originated as a spinoff from Delft University of Technology (TU Delft). Current BlueBee investors include Buysse & Partners, Korys, Quest for Growth, Capricorn Partners, Heran Partners, Delft Enterprises and Participatie Maatschappij Vlaanderen.

Just last month, BlueBee partnered with TruGenomix, a developer of next-generation genomic diagnostics for PTSD and other behavioral health conditions, through a biomarker-based risk assessment collaboration focused on behavioral health that a BlueBee spokesperson told GEN sister publication Clinical OMICs was hastened by the COVID-19 pandemic.

In announcing its acquisition of BlueBee, Illumina included comments from two BlueBee customers: Trey Martin, president of Integrated DNA Technologies; and Mark Straley, CEO of Agendia.

Agendia already combines Illumina’s genomic testing platform with BlueBee cloud computing services in order to secure, accurate and timely testing through two of its tests: BluePrint, a molecular subtyping test that analyzes 80 genes to enable stratification of tumors into Luminal, HER2, and Basal; and MammaPrint, a test designed to advise women on their risk of breast cancer recurrence.
